In Los Cabos, the desert heat meets the Pacific spray with a specific, dehydrating intensity. You come for the salt air, but your skin quickly demands a reprieve. The real decision isn't just about booking a treatment. It’s about choosing between the clinical perfection of a resort sanctuary and the rugged, earth-bound rituals unique to Baja.

The landscape has shifted from standard massage menus to immersive, high-concept retreats. THE WELL at Chileno Bay brings a New York sensibility to the coastline, focusing on holistic alignment. At Le Blanc’s Aura Spa, the hydrotherapy circuit serves as a cool, marble-clad refuge from the midday sun. Spa Alkemia ditches the typical lobby vibe for garden-shrouded therapy rooms. Many of these sanctuaries welcome day guests, making a trip down the Corridor worth the drive.
